Radiation Oncologist visa sponsorship salary

Across 8 certified work-visa filings, the median wage for Radiation Oncologist is $460,000. The middle half of filings fall between $369,684 and $516,250, and the top decile begins at $620,500. Classified under SOC 29-1229.00 (Physicians, All Other).

Prevailing wage levels I through IV reflect the experience and responsibility the employer attested to, not seniority titles. A level I filing is an entry-level determination; level IV is fully competent and independent. Comparing across levels explains much of the spread between the 25th and 90th percentile above.
